Doxil and Oesophagitis aggravated - a phase IV clinical study of FDA data
Summary:
Oesophagitis aggravated is reported as a side effect among people who take Doxil (doxorubicin hydrochloride), especially for people who are female, 50-59 old, have been taking the drug for < 1 month also take Zometa, and have Pain.
The phase IV clinical study analyzes which people have Oesophagitis aggravated when taking Doxil. It is created by eHealthMe based on reports of 10,418 people who have side effects when taking Doxil from the FDA, and is updated regularly.

10,418 people reported to have side effects when taking Doxil.
Among them, 49 people (0.47%) have Oesophagitis aggravated.

Among these 49 people:
How long have people been on Doxil when they have Oesophagitis aggravated? *
- < 1 month: 66.67 %
- 1 - 6 months: 33.33 %
- 6 - 12 months: 0.0 %
- 1 - 2 years: 0.0 %
- 2 - 5 years: 0.0 %
- 5 - 10 years: 0.0 %
- 10+ years: 0.0 %
What is the gender of people who have Oesophagitis aggravated when taking Doxil? *
- female: 81.25 %
- male: 18.75 %
What is the age of people who have Oesophagitis aggravated when taking Doxil? *
- 0-1: 0.0 %
- 2-9: 0.0 %
- 10-19: 4.88 %
- 20-29: 0.0 %
- 30-39: 0.0 %
- 40-49: 21.95 %
- 50-59: 58.54 %
- 60+: 14.63 %

How the study uses the data?
The study uses data from the FDA. It is based on doxorubicin hydrochloride (the active ingredients of Doxil) and Doxil (the brand name). Other drugs that have the same active ingredients (e.g. generic drugs) are not considered. Dosage of drugs is not considered in the study.
